Detective Cassandra Shaffer of The Ohio State University Police Department speaks about personal safety. Great for teens and their caregivers.

Teens and their caregivers are invited to attend this presentation by Detective Cassandra Shaffer of The Ohio State University Police Department.  Detective Shaffer's focus will be on assessing risk and basic safety on a college campus, but will contain information applicable to any teen interested in learning more about safety.

No registration is required.

About the branch

The Orange Branch Library is located in Orange Township just north of the township's fire station, park and pool. At 33,000 square feet, this branch has a drive-up book drop and drive through pick-up window, along with many other special sustainable building features. The building also houses our Outreach Services Department and the Imagination Garden.
